Amandula Anderson serves on Cinnaire’s Board of Directors.
Amandula is First Vice President & Manager of Nonprofit Services at the National Bank of Indianapolis where she leads her team to unlock opportunities for nonprofits and communities across central Indiana.
Amandula has more than 20 years’ experience in the nonprofit sector. She served as IFF’s Executive Director for the Indiana Region, charged with oversight of IFF’s full scope of services in Indiana and Louisville, KY, and IFF’s Managing Director of Real Estate Solutions – Indiana, working alongside nonprofit organizations to help them build, move, or expand their space in order to meet the needs of their clients.
Prior to joining IFF, she led two community-based organizations – Irvington Development Organization and United Northeast CDC, convened a Quality-of-Life initiative on the northeast side of Indianapolis, directed a program to facilitate a two-generational approach to supporting families within five Indianapolis communities, and spent a few years supporting affordable housing through a tax credit syndicator.
